Mechanisms compared
Metformin: Metformin's principal effect is to suppress hepatic glucose production by inhibiting mitochondrial complex I, which raises the cellular AMP/ATP ratio and activates AMP-activated protein kinase. Lorazepam: Lorazepam binds the benzodiazepine site of the GABA-A receptor and allosterically enhances the action of the inhibitory neurotransmitter GABA.
Indications compared
Metformin: Metformin is indicated as first-line oral therapy in adults and selected paediatric populations with type 2 diabetes mellitus, alone or in combination with other antidiabetic agents, including insulin. Safety profile
Metformin: The most common adverse effects are gastrointestinal: nausea, diarrhoea, abdominal discomfort and metallic taste, often improved by gradual titration, food intake or use of the extended-release formulation. Lorazepam: Common adverse effects include sedation, drowsiness, dizziness, ataxia and memory impairment.
